新聞中心
HTML文本編輯器是一種用于編寫和編輯HTML代碼的軟件工具,它提供了便捷的界面和功能,使用戶能夠輕松地創(chuàng)建、修改和預(yù)覽網(wǎng)頁。
如何創(chuàng)建HTML文本編輯器

創(chuàng)建一個(gè)HTML文本編輯器需要一些基本的HTML和JavaScript知識(shí),以下是一些基本步驟:
1. 創(chuàng)建基本結(jié)構(gòu)
我們需要在HTML中創(chuàng)建一個(gè)基本的文本區(qū)域,用戶可以在其中輸入和編輯文本,我們可以使用標(biāo)簽來實(shí)現(xiàn)這一點(diǎn):
2. 添加樣式
接下來,我們可以為文本編輯器添加一些樣式,我們可以設(shè)置字體、顏色、背景色等,這可以通過CSS來實(shí)現(xiàn):
#editor {
font-family: monospace;
color: #000;
background-color: #fff;
}
3. 添加功能
我們還可以添加一些功能,如保存和加載文本,這需要使用JavaScript來實(shí)現(xiàn),我們可以添加兩個(gè)按鈕,一個(gè)用于保存文本,另一個(gè)用于加載文本:
我們可以使用以下JavaScript代碼來保存和加載文本:
function saveText() {
localStorage.setItem('text', document.getElementById('editor').value);
}
function loadText() {
document.getElementById('editor').value = localStorage.getItem('text');
}
相關(guān)問題與解答
Q1: 我可以使用什么方法來增強(qiáng)文本編輯器的功能?
A1: 你可以使用各種JavaScript庫和框架來增強(qiáng)文本編輯器的功能,你可能會(huì)想要添加語法高亮、自動(dòng)完成或行號等功能,有許多現(xiàn)成的庫可以幫助你實(shí)現(xiàn)這些功能,如CodeMirror和Ace。
Q2: 我可以將文本編輯器的內(nèi)容保存到服務(wù)器而不是本地存儲(chǔ)嗎?
A2: 是的,你可以使用AJAX或Fetch API將文本發(fā)送到服務(wù)器,你需要在服務(wù)器端設(shè)置一個(gè)接收和保存文本的端點(diǎn),你可以使用JavaScript來發(fā)送POST請求,將文本作為請求體發(fā)送出去。
文章標(biāo)題:如何html文本編輯器
新聞來源:http://m.fisionsoft.com.cn/article/cddeheh.html


咨詢
建站咨詢
